Why These Are the Top Subaru Repair Auto Repair Shops in Costa Mesa

The Subaru repair market in Costa Mesa is robust and competitive, reflecting the brand's strong popularity in Southern California. The quality of specialized service is generally high, with several independent shops offering expertise that meets or exceeds dealership standards, often at a 20-30% lower cost. The market is segmented into general Japanese auto specialists (like A-1 and Japanese Auto Service) and performance-focused tuner shops (like Renner Motorsports). Pricing is typical for the Orange County area, with labor rates ranging from $130-$180/hour. Common Subaru issues, such as head gasket failures on older NA models and CVT concerns on newer ones, are well within the capabilities of the top specialists. Customers have excellent options for both routine maintenance and complex, model-specific repairs, reducing the necessity to rely solely on the dealership network.

What are the most common Subaru repair issues for drivers in Costa Mesa?

Costa Mesa's mix of coastal air and stop-and-go freeway traffic makes head gasket failures on older models (like the Outback and Forester) and CVT transmission issues prevalent. We also frequently service Subarus for check engine lights related to the air-fuel ratio and oxygen sensors, which are sensitive to the local driving conditions.

How can I find a reputable, specialized Subaru repair shop in Costa Mesa?

Look for shops that are Subaru-specific or have dedicated Subaru master technicians, as they will have the latest diagnostic tools for Symmetrical AWD systems. Check for certifications like ASE and read local reviews on platforms like Google and Yelp that mention positive experiences with Subaru models commonly driven in Orange County.

When should I seek service for my Subaru's All-Wheel Drive system in this area?

You should have the AWD system and differentials inspected if you notice unusual vibrations or binding, especially after beach driving or frequent trips to nearby hiking areas like the Back Bay. Regular fluid changes for the differentials and transmission are crucial due to the strain of coastal humidity and traffic.
